Parasailing looks scary from a distance, but when you’re in the air — 400 feet in the air — it magnifies the beauty of the landscape below you. Some say it’s a life changing experience for them, one they can’t wait to experience again!

Everyone has something different to say about their experience. To know what impact parasailing in the open skies will have on you, why don’t you join us in Destin? Our boats have the capacity to hold twelve people. You can come as a single or in groups of two, three, or more.

Our parasailing equipment can hold two to three people side by side. We inspect our parasailing equipment daily to ensure you have a fun, safe, and thrilling ride.
